RESTRICTED AND EXCLUDED ARTWORKS

Copyright Agency’s member artists, and artists’ beneficiaries, give us the right under their membership agreement to license the use of their works. In many cases, Copyright Agency can grant licences directly, without having to check with the artist first. In some cases, however, the artist has asked us for a right of “prior approval” for certain works or uses. This means that we have to check your proposed usage with the artist before we can grant a licence.

Some of our licences are “transactional”, that is, one-off licences for specific projects involving one work or a defined group of works. In other cases, we grant “blanket” licences that cover our entire visual arts repertoire. In the case of blanket licences, some works in our repertoire might be excluded from use under that licence or require prior approval from the artist before they can be used under the licence.

The following table and search tool allows licensing customers to check whether there are any restrictions or exclusions associated with a particular artist’s works.
